Sprowston Road is in Norwich and in Norwich district. NR3 4QJ is located in the Sewell electoral ward, within the English Parliamentary constituency of Norwich North. This postcode has been in use since 1980-01-01.

People

Gender

In the UK, the overall gender distribution is approximately 49% male and 51% female. However, the area surrounding NR3 4QJ is primarily male, with 53.2% of the population being male. Several factors can contribute to this, including areas with industries or sectors that predominantly employ men, proximity to universities or technical schools with a higher enrollment of male students, presence of all-male or predominantly male institutions (military academies, boarding schools).

Partnership Status

Across the UK, the average relationship status breakdown is roughly 44% married, 38% single, 9% divorced, 6% widowed, and 2% separated.

In the immediate area around NR3 4QJ, a significant portion of the population is single, making up 67.1% of the residents. On average, approximately 38% of individuals who responded to the census in the UK were single. Areas with higher single populations are typically urban centers, university towns, regions with dynamic job markets, rich cultural offerings and entertainment facilities. These regions also tend to have a younger demographic.

Health

Across the UK, the average 48.4% rated their health as Very Good, 33.6% as Good, 12.7% as Fair, 4% as Bad, and 1.2% as Very Bad.

Population age significantly impacts residents' health. Additionally, socioeconomic status plays a crucial role: higher income levels and lower poverty rates are linked to better health outcomes. Affluent areas benefit from higher living standards, access to private healthcare, and healthier lifestyle choices.

This area has a high percentage of residents reporting their health as Good or Very Good (85.7%) compared to the average (82%). This typically indicates either a younger population or more affluent area.

Safety

Is Sprowston Road dangerous?

Over the last 12 months, the overall crime rate around Sprowston Road was 51.6 per 1,000 residents, which is 31.2% lower than the Sewell average. The most reported crime type was Shoplifting.

Sprowston Road has the 14th lowest crime rate of 34 local areas in Sewell and the 149th lowest crime rate of 442 local areas in Norwich .

Violent and sexual offences accounted for around 19.8 crimes per 1,000 residents and have been rising year on year. Over the last decade, overall crime has risen by about 25.8%.

Employment

NR3 4QJ area has a low unemployment rate. According to Census 2021, 3% residents of this area were unemployed, while the average in the UK was 4.83%. A low level of unemployment in an area indicates a strong job market, where most people who are seeking work can find employment. This generally reflects a healthy economy in the area.
